Description
WordPress Plugin Email Subscribers by Icegram Express-Email Marketing, Newsletters, Automation for WordPress & WooCommerce is prone to an SQL injection vulnerability because it fails to sufficiently sanitize user-supplied data before using it in an SQL query. Exploiting this issue could allow an attacker to compromise the application, access or modify data, or exploit latent vulnerabilities in the underlying database. WordPress Plugin Email Subscribers by Icegram Express-Email Marketing, Newsletters, Automation for WordPress & WooCommerce version 5.7.23 is vulnerable; prior versions may also be affected.
Remediation
Update to plugin version 5.7.24 or latest
